Small Glue Coating Machine

A small glue coating machine evenly applies adhesive onto the surface of substrates using rollers or blades, and is used for the composite processing of materials such as paper and films. During operation, the substrate passes through the coating head to complete the adhesive application, and then undergoes drying and curing to form a coating layer. It is suitable for laboratory sample preparation and small-batch production, enabling the testing of the coating effects of different adhesives.
Selection
When selecting, consider matching the substrate width to the coating width and ensuring the glue viscosity is suitable for the coating head type. Choose a melting tank for hot melt adhesives and a drying system for water-based adhesives. Select a micro-gravure roller or doctor blade based on coating thickness requirements, with experimental applications prioritizing parameter adjustability. Pay attention to the corrosion resistance of roller materials and the ease of equipment cleaning.

How to choose a laboratory coater? Which one should you buy: wire bar, scraper, or slot die?
This article introduces three methods for selecting laboratory coating machines: wire bar coating is suitable for low-viscosity coatings, offering low cost and simple operation; blade coating is ideal for medium-to-high viscosity slurries or those containing particles, with a wide range of film thickness control; slot-die coating provides the highest precision and is suitable for high-end applications such as electronic films.
Comparison of Coating Accuracy between Laboratory Blade Coater and Slot Die Coater
This article compares the coating precision of blade coaters and slot-die coaters in the laboratory. Blade coaters are suitable for thick coatings, with simple operation but relatively large uniformity errors; slot-die coaters offer higher precision and better uniformity for thin coatings. The choice of equipment depends on coating thickness and precision requirements.

How to Coat High-Viscosity Slurry – Parameter Setting Tips for Blade Coaters
This article primarily discusses the parameter setting techniques for high-viscosity slurries on blade coaters. High-viscosity slurries exhibit characteristics such as shear thinning, so it is essential to leverage shear effects during coating to facilitate slurry spreading. After coating, the viscosity should recover quickly to prevent sagging.
